Output ddc28616fe3a7d9ee052b7bd7ea277b837ef4e437fe2afa2c75eaaa3ccf292bf:17

value
312872
script pubkey
OP_0 OP_PUSHBYTES_20 68befb86aa11f7670c0bc669ec34fac1bb0a9cf4
address
bc1qdzl0hp42z8mkwrqtce57cd86cxas4885c4762h
transaction
ddc28616fe3a7d9ee052b7bd7ea277b837ef4e437fe2afa2c75eaaa3ccf292bf
spent
true